Alteryx is a powerful data analytics and automation platform that allows users to prepare, analyze, and visualize data through an intuitive drag-and-drop interface. Think of it as a visual workflow builder for data processes—no programming background required. Users can connect to various data sources, clean and blend data, run advanced analytics, and generate insights—all within one easy-to-use platform.
At its core, Alteryx simplifies time-consuming and repetitive tasks, turning them into automated workflows that can be run with just a click.

At the heart of Alteryx lies its drag-and-drop workflow interface. Instead of writing code, users build workflows by connecting different tools visually. Each step in the workflow is easy to trace, making it simple to debug or adjust as needed.
Whether you're merging data tables or applying a complex algorithm, everything is done in an intuitive canvas that shows your entire process at a glance.
Alteryx lets users build workflows that can be reused or scheduled to run automatically. This is perfect for tasks that need to be performed regularly, such as weekly sales reports or monthly customer segmentation.
Automation reduces manual intervention, which not only saves time but also reduces errors, making your analytics process more reliable.
With built-in statistical and machine learning tools, Alteryx supports advanced data modeling without requiring expertise in coding. You can run linear regression, logistic regression, decision trees, clustering, and more using preconfigured tools.
For users who want to go deeper, Alteryx also integrates with R and Python, allowing analysts to extend the platform's capabilities with custom scripts.
Alteryx includes specialized tools for working with location-based data. This feature allows users to perform spatial joins, distance calculations, route optimization, and geographic visualizations. It's widely used in retail site selection, logistics planning, and market expansion strategies.
Alteryx plays well with other platforms. It integrates seamlessly with tools like Tableau, Power BI, Salesforce, Snowflake, AWS, and Google BigQuery. This means you can push or pull data across different environments without needing custom connectors or complex scripts.
